Racing crickets in school
Does anyone know if this was actually a thing kids did in Anne's time? It's mentioned in Green Gables, one of Anne's classmates has crickets harnessed to string and is driving them around while Mr. Phillips is distracted. It's mentioned again in Anne of Avonlea when she has to confiscate some "trained crickets" from a student. I've always wondered about that part, was it really such a common thing? I tried googling it but came up with nothing. I'm really curious.

How does a new clerk at a Carmody store know Matthew Cuthbert's name?
The very next evening Matthew betook himself to Carmody to buy the dress ...Matthew did not know that Samuel, in the recent expansion of his business, had set up a lady clerk also; she was a niece of his wifeās ...
āWhat can I do for you this evening, Mr. Cuthbert?ā Miss Lucilla Harris inquired,....
Map: http://home.clara.net/hendricks/kindreds/avonl.gif
Judging by the map above, Carmody is about 5 kilometres away from Avonlea. That is quite a long distance back then when cars or buses did not exist, right? How does she know Matthew's name? Did he first introduced himself like "Hello, my name is Mr Cuthbert." and the novel omitted that part? In the Japanese animation adaptation, he did not say such a thing and as soon as she saw him, she said "Hello, Mr Cuthbert...., is that right? What can I get for you?"
Was it a natural thing at that time that people knew the names of all other people living in a 5km radius?

I was shocked to read this:
The nature of the novels of LM Montgomery are usually not dark. These novels don't have violence, sex scenes, the F word (and other profanity). These novels are supposed to be appropriate for people of all ages to read.
That is why I was shocked when I read this in one of LM Montgomery's novels. The novel is "The Story girl":
"Cecily asked him what he would feel like if Jimmy was never, never found. The Story Girl had a gruesome recollection of some baby at Markdale who had wandered away like thatā
'And they never found him till the next spring, and all they found wasāHIS SKELETON, with the grass growing through it,' she whispered."
Why did LM Montgomery mention a skeleton being found in one of her novels??? I thought that was too morbid for the tone and nature of LM Montgomery's novels.
